Integrating Technology in Architectural Planning

With the ongoing evolution of technology, its integration into architectural planning has become crucial for improving design efficiency and effectiveness. Architects now leverage advanced software tools like Building Information Modeling (BIM) to create comprehensive, three-dimensional representations of structures, allowing for better visualization and collaboration among stakeholders. Moreover, virtual reality (VR) and augmented reality (AR) enable clients to experience designs before construction, ensuring that their needs are met. Geographic Information Systems (GIS) play a vital role in site analysis and environmental impact assessments, delivering data-driven insights for sustainable design. Automation tools streamline repetitive tasks, allowing architects to focus on creative aspects. In summary, technology not only strengthens accuracy and reduces errors but also fosters innovative solutions in the architectural planning process.

Environmentally Conscious Urban Growth

Environmentally conscious urban projects represent a significant shift in architectural practice, tackling the urgent need for environmentally sustainable designs in densely populated zones. Recent case studies highlight innovative projects that feature green technologies and sustainable materials. For instance, the High Line in New York City transformed an abandoned railway into a thriving public park, fostering biodiversity and community engagement. Similarly, the Bosco Verticale in Milan features vertical forests that enhance air quality and reduce urban heat. By combining renewable energy sources, efficient waste management systems, and green spaces, these projects demonstrate how architecture can mitigate climate change impacts. Eventually, sustainable urban developments not only elevate urban aesthetics but also foster healthier living environments, underscoring the value of ecological considerations in contemporary architecture.

What Instruments Do Architects Employ for Design and Planning?

Architecture professionals utilize several tools for architectural design and planning, including CAD (CAD) software, 3D modeling programs, physical models, sketching tools, and project management applications to enhance creativity and optimize workflow during the architectural process.

What Methods Do Architects Use to Handle Project Budget Constraints?

Architects handle project budget boundaries by prioritizing essential features, working with clients to establish realistic goals, sourcing budget-friendly materials, and employing innovative design strategies that increase functionality while meeting financial constraints and requirements.
